Spousal Maintenance Awarded In Kentucky

Spousal maintenance is by no means a given in every divorce. Spousal maintenance, also referred to as alimony or spousal support, orders one spouse to provide financial support to the other for a period of time. There are three distinct types:

  • Permanent. Granted indefinitely, permanent spousal maintenance is typically only awarded in select situations.
  • Temporary. One of the most common forms of alimony, temporary spousal maintenance is awarded briefly, typically for the duration of the divorce proceeding.
  • Rehabilitative. Meant to assist those in need of a boost, rehabilitative spousal maintenance is granted on a temporary period of up to several years.

Spousal maintenance is determined by examining several factors of the two divorcing spouses, including length of the marriage, income of both individuals, the period of time that the receiving individual would need to become self-sufficient and more.

Spousal maintenance can be a contentious issue. For potential payors, you may fear paying a significant portion of your income to your ex-spouse indefinitely. For potential recipients, you may fear a diminished standard of living. Especially for those who sacrificed careers to maintain the home or to be the primary caregiver, spousal maintenance can be a central topic in a divorce proceeding.
